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2172273713 50676385 2096
5736202 8995734450
5736202 8995734450
673 27 973237239
All about undefined
Interested in learning more?
5736202 8995734450
673 27 973237239
See more
75922 8181
19 5466538 6710 6424068
See more
3009 1634621781
53848156 01220430991 570
See more